Understanding the Wiring Variations Challenge
Here's something critical that many DIYers don't realize: Ford's published wiring diagrams don't always match what's actually under your hood. The manual addresses this head-on, explaining that you should cross-reference multiple diagrams to find matches with your specific vehicle. This happens because Ford made running changes during production—minor wire color variations that occurred during short manufacturing runs but never made it into updated diagrams.
The solution? The manual provides a comprehensive wire identification reference table listing numbered wires with their color and stripe descriptions, sourced from multiple Ford documents (Forms 7760-69 and FD-7795P-69). When you find a connector where one wire doesn't match the diagram exactly, you can identify it by comparing the other wires at that same connector. It's this kind of practical troubleshooting advice that separates useful manuals from mere collections of diagrams.
Real-World Application: Systematic Troubleshooting
The manual doesn't just throw diagrams at you—it teaches a methodology. For vacuum systems (critical for controlling everything from headlight doors to HVAC functions), it recommends starting with the total systems schematic to identify branch systems sharing the same vacuum source, then tracing from the control unit to the vacuum source and finally to the operating unit. This systematic approach saves hours of random testing.
For electrical diagnosis, all relays and switches are shown in the "system off" position, which is crucial for understanding circuit behavior. The manual explains that colored connectors aren't just decorative—they're specifically included to help you identify and trace circuits during testing, while standard disconnects remain black.
